Abstract | ||||
This research presents a comprehensive model for the application of artificial intelligence in Egyptian universities with the aim of enhancing academic and administrative performance. The study highlights the main applications of artificial intelligence, including predictive analytics of student performance, smart resource management, automated communication systems, and the integration of artificial intelligence technologies into curriculum design and institutional decision-making processes. These applications are expected to address contemporary challenges in the higher education sector, such as increasing student engagement, streamlining processes, and enhancing innovation. The research relied on a descriptive analytical methodology to assess the current status of artificial intelligence adoption in Egyptian universities. The dimensions of artificial intelligence considered in this study included machine learning, natural language processing, computer vision, and robotics. To validate the proposed model, advanced statistical techniques, such as AMOS, were used to measure the correlations between these dimensions and their impact on Egyptian universities. The results confirmed the existence of significant correlations, indicating that the adoption of artificial intelligence can significantly improve operational efficiency, innovation, and strategic decision-making. The study concludes by developing a final model that provides actionable insights and a practical framework for the application of artificial intelligence in universities. The research recommends upgrading digital infrastructure, implementing comprehensive AI training programs for employees, and developing clear policies that encourage the integration of AI technologies into all university functions. | ||||
